Meet the Founders: Adam D’Angelo and Charlie Cheever

Quora was co-founded by Adam D’Angelo and Charlie Cheever in June 2009. Both D’Angelo and Cheever were former Facebook employees, with D’Angelo serving as the Chief Technology Officer and Cheever working as an engineer.

Adam D’Angelo: The Tech Whiz

Adam D’Angelo, a graduate of the California Institute of Technology, was one of the earliest employees at Facebook. He served as the Chief Technology Officer and was instrumental in the development of many of Facebook’s core features. However, in 2008, D’Angelo left Facebook to start his own venture, which would eventually become Quora.

Charlie Cheever: The Engineering Expert

Charlie Cheever, an alumnus of Harvard University, worked at both Amazon and Facebook before co-founding Quora. At Facebook, Cheever was involved in the creation of Facebook Connect and the Facebook Platform. His experience in building platforms played a crucial role in the development of Quora.

The Birth of Quora

After leaving Facebook, D’Angelo and Cheever set out to create a platform that would share and grow the world’s knowledge. They believed that many people have valuable insights and answers, but there was no ideal place to share them. Thus, Quora was born. The platform was made available to the public in 2010, and it quickly gained popularity due to its unique approach to information sharing.

Quora’s Unique Approach

Unlike other Q&A platforms, Quora focuses on providing high-quality answers. The platform uses a system of upvotes and downvotes to rank answers, ensuring that the most helpful ones rise to the top. Additionally, Quora allows users to follow topics and people, creating a personalized feed of information. This unique approach has made Quora a go-to resource for reliable answers on a wide range of topics.

The Legacy of Quora’s Founders

While Cheever left Quora in 2012, D’Angelo continues to serve as the CEO. Under their leadership, Quora has grown into a platform with millions of users worldwide. The founders’ vision of creating a space for sharing and growing knowledge has undoubtedly been realized.
